The Log Cabin Lone Star Quilt is a beautiful combination of two traditional patterns, the Log Cabin and the Lone Star. Surrounded by a beautiful scalloped border, this quilt was handcrafted by Lizzie Miller using 238 yards of thread. On a queen bed, this quilt will allow 19.5 inches of drop per side.
Measures 99″ wide x 110″ long.

Although the fabric pieces are stitched by machine to guarantee tighter stitching, all the quilting is done by hand. 100% cotton materials make up the top and bottom of the quilt. The batting sandwiched in between those two layers, nevertheless, is 100% polyester. This polyester batting guaranties both heat as well as outstanding washing outcomes.
Just about all of our quilts are generous enough to overcome the need for a dust ruffle and pillow shams. Just as mattress heights are different, each quilt's size is different. We list the quilt's dimensions in addition to the calculated drop for you to compare to the measurements you may need. The term handmade is typically utilized to describe crafts produced by a craftsman rather than a manufacturing facility. Each handmade quilt is unique because it is not mass-produced. Not all the stitching in a hand-made quilt is done by hand. Just as the woodcrafter makes use of mechanical tools to create his workmanship, our seamstresses use various devices to craft these quilts. The seamstress cuts her items with a rotary knife and also stitch them with each other on the sewing machine. The quilter works with just needle, thread, and thimble to quilt hundreds of small stitches throughout the quilt.
